Melavasal Slum originated in 1905-1910 and was initially considered a waste land. It has grown heavily populated due to people taking up waste sorting as an income source. The slum residents face difficulties as the location is far from amenities like hospitals, schools, and ration shops - requiring significant transportation costs. Over 200 slums exist in total in Madurai, with inhabitants of one slum seeking to relocate closer to available resources and facilities.
